1. Introduction
Collection and printing log and alarm messages
Logs and Alarms are collected for TOPS Voice Service Node (VSN) using the
log and alarm subsystem installed in base TOPS VSN software. The same
subsystem is responsible for creating log and alarm reports. These are stored
temporarily on the TOPS VSN and can be sent to a printer or to a terminal for
continuous display. TOPS VSN uses a dedicated printer to report its log
messages.
Predefined log and alarm configuration datafill is delivered to the operating
company as part of the TOPS VSN installation tapes.

Header Information For TOPS VSN Log Messages.
Identifying information, also known as header information, uniquely identifies
each log and alarm message. The header of every log or alarm message
generated by TOPS VSN contains the following:
(a) Date and Time. The date and time are displayed in the upper left of the
message. The format of the date is yymmdd, and the format of the time is
hh:mm.
(b) Severity. Each log message specifies the severity of the event it is
reporting. The following terms or values are used to indicate severity:
*C Critical Severity 1 Logs with this severity generate critical
alarms. These logs and alarms are the result
of catastrophic failures such as power
failures.
** Major Severity 2 Logs with this severity generate major
alarms. These logs and alarms are the result
serious failures such as PRUs being unable
to initialize.
* Minor Severity 3 Logs with this severity generate minor
alarms. These alarms are used to flag
problems that need either a visual or
audible display at the TOPS VSN site. An
example of a problem that would cause a
minor alarm is an incorrect table entry.
GEvent
GError
LEvent
LError
Severity 4
Severity 5
Severity 6
Severity 7
These are intermediate severity ratings. An
event is a happening that does not effect
service. The event is simply logged for the
record. An error is also considered non-
service affecting. It is an isolated error
condition caused by the system, for
example, a single lost call.
Warning/
Trouble Severity 8 This log severity indicates a warning.
Status Severity 9 This log severity reports the status of a
particular software or hardware unit. The
percentage of disk space used is an
example of a log with status severity.
Progress Severity 10 Log reports the progress of an event.
Severity 11-13 These severity ratings are not defined for
TOPS VSN.
Introduction 3
TOPS VSN Log and alarm messages
Status 14 Status 14 Used for login/logout security related
events. This status is now used by all logs
generated from two DVS subsystems
(8029 System Administration (Report #1
only, and 8039 Security Agent Sub-PRU).
The logs produced from these two
subsystems identify logins, logouts,
changes to USERIDs and Admin objects.
Information Status 15 This log severity is used for informational
purposes only.
(c) Subsystem Number. The subsystem number is a four-digit hexadecimal
number that identifies a message subsystem. For example, the subsystem
number for TOPS VSN common logs is 0200 to 020A. Each program
resource unit (PRU) that generates logs has its own subsystem; the common
logs are shared by all TOPS VSN PRUs.
The following list identifies the number associated with each PRU:
0200 - Common Logs - Run Errors
0201 - Common Logs - Tasking Errors
0202 - Common Logs - I/O Errors
0203 - Common Logs - VTP Errors
020A - TOPS VSN Common Logs
0220 - VI Resource Manager Logs
8722 - Alarms PRU
9440 - ACPE Resource Manager Logs
9441 - Control Link Logs
9442 - ACPE Logs + ACPE Executor
9443 - T1 Resource Manager Logs
9445 - ACPE Maintenance Position
(d) Report Number. Report numbers are hexadecimal numbers. They identify
the group or category within the subsystem file the message belongs to. For
TOPS VSN common log messages, the following numbering convention
applies:
Number Type
0000 Nonspecified error types
0001 Run errors
0002 Tasking errors
0003 IO errors
(e) Error Number. Error numbers are hexadecimal numbers. They identify the
specific error condition within each report number grouping.

2. TOPS VSN log messages
TOPS VSN log messages are separated into two groups: common logs, and
PRU-specific logs. Each group generates logs from a single subsystem (in most
cases a subsystem is defined by a PRU). This Publication uses separate tables for
each subsystem that generates logs.
The first six tables list logs that are common to TOPS VSN as a whole. These
logs are generated from base software but have specific application to TOPS
VSN. With these logs there is no one-to-one correspondence between subsystem
and PRU. The remaining tables list logs by software (PRU) subsystem. A
complete list of logs generated from base software is given in Publication
450-1301-511.
Accompanying each log entry is a definition and a description of the action the
user must take to respond to the log. This Publication contains the following log
sections:

12. Control link log messages - 9441
0000/0000
Message:
Data Link [link_identifier] to DMS [common_language_location
_identifier] is in service.
Description:
This log is generated when the X.25 Control Link has been
reset. At initialization time this log is considered a normal occurrence. At any
other time it is not. Data may have been lost depending on the activity in
progress at the time of the reset.
Action:
No action is required. The condition indicates that a link is now
available. If data was lost, if cannot be recovered.
0000/0001
Message:
Data Link [link_identifier] to DMS [common _language_location
_identifier] is out of service. Reason = [reason].
Description:
This log is generated when the X.25 Control Link is no longer
available for use. Data may have been lost depending on the activity in
progress at the time of the reset. The reason may be one of the following: 1)
X.25 PRU managing link is down ( The X.25 PRU is out of service), or 2) Link is
down (X.25 service associated with the physical link has been reset and is no
longer available).
Action:
No action is required if within 30 seconds a log is generated
indicating that the specified data link is now available. If this log does not follow,
check all physical connections. If all are in good order, the problem is likely
associated with a DMS failure (i.e.. MPC card). If the reason given is X.25 PRU
Failure, the PRU must be returned to service. If a return to service does not
happen automatically, it means the maximum fault count limit has been
exceeded. This indicates that the processor is in trouble.
0000/0002
Message:
Data Link PRU has bad initialization data.
Reason = [reason].
4
Description:
This log is generated when invalid data has been found in
"Datalink_Config" or "VSN_System" tables for a particular Data Link (DL) PRU.
The reason given may be one of the following: 1) too many links (more than 4
links have been configured for each DL PRU), 2) Data Link tables are missing 3)
no links defined in tables (no links are defined in Datalink_Config table), 4) X.25
PRU referenced in table does not exist (the X.25 PRU number in Datalink
Config table does not exist), 5) no call sanity timeout parameter defined in
VSN_System table, 6) No maximum calls allowed parameter defined in
VSN_System table, 7) no VSN identifier defined in VSN_System table, 8) two
different DMS CLLIs defined for one Data Link PRU.
Action:
Modify data entry in Datalink_Config or VSN_System tables, then
reinitialize the failed DL PRU.
58 Control Link Log Messages (9441)
TOPS VSN Log and alarm messages
0000/0003
Message:
A Datalink message was discarded. Destination = [DMS_or_VSN].
Reason = [reason].
Message Type = [message_type].
Description:
This log is generated when the X.25 Datalink software
encounters a problem sending a message. The reason is one of the following:
1) Message type received from application is not supported, 2) Message type
received on link is not supported, 3) problem relaying message to X.25
(outgoing message could not be sent to X.25 for transmission), 4) too many
messages for Datalink PRU to manage (PRU has received more messages than
it can send out), 5) problem relaying message to VSN application (message
received by AABS could not be relayed to VSN), 6) attempt to send message to
a DMS that is not supported, 7) attempt to send message with invalid callID.
Action:
If both data links have failed, then reboot the PRUs involved. If the
problem is not failed data links, contact NT for support.
0000/0004
Message:
Datalink PRU received a message from an unknown link. Software
location = [message_received_by].
4
Description:
This log indicates a serious internal problem. The location
given may be either 1) xmtHandler (Datalink's transmit handler), or 2) nData
Reply (Datalink's X.25 data acknowledgement entry).
Action:
Contact NT immediately.
0000/0005
Message:
Data Link PRU encountered an event while in an incorrect internal
state.
Event = @ & 27* current state = @ & 27*
Description:
This log indicates that a Datalink PRU encountered an event
that should not have happened while in its current internal state. This may
indicate an internal problem.
Run Time Parameters (RTP)
First RTP is a string indicating what the new event is.
Second RTP is a string indicating what the current state is.
Action:
If the problem persists, retain all of the information regarding the
problem and contact your NT representative.
0000/0006
Message:
Datalink PRU's outgoing message queue reached a module 10
length. Number of messages in queue = [num_message].
4
Description:
The Datalink PRU maintains a queue of messages that are
outbound, that is destined for the DMS. When this queue grow large, some
delays may occur in user interaction. This log indicates how large this queue
has grown when it reaches a size which is a multiple of 10.
Action:
No action required. This message is for informational purposes only.
0000/0007
Message:
An outgoing message was in the Data Link PRU's queue for an
abnormally long time. Time in milliseconds = [time].
4
Description:
The Datalink PRU maintains a queue of messages that are
outbound, that is destined for the DMS. When this queue grow large, some
delays may occur in user interaction. This log indicates how long a message has
been in the queue before it was transmitted if the time is greater than 3
seconds.
Action:
No action required. This message is for informational purposes only.

0001/0000
Message:
T1 Link Error for T1 SRU in Cabinet [cabinet_id], Slot [slot_id].
Condition = [string]. Error Level = [string].
Description:
There is a link error for the T1 SRU at the specified location.
The reason (condition) for the error is one of the following: 1) Bipolar violation,
2) Frame slip, 3) Frame loss, 4) Frequency converter unlock, 5) VBus collision,
6) Line fail, 7) Transmit clock fail, 8) 5ms clock, 9) Peripheral loopback, 10)
Yellow alarm, 11) Red alarm, 12) A/B buffer overrun.
The error level is one of the following: 1) Error Cleared, 2) Maintenance Limit
Attained, 3) Out-of-service limit attained. If the maintenance level is reached,
the link is still operational. If the out-of-service limit is reached, the T1 link is
taken out of service.
Action:
Adjust thresholds using digitial trunk link configuration service.
Make sure that the synchronization manager is operational, and that the T1 link
is connected properly.
0001/0001
Message:
T1 Link Event for T1 SRU in Cabinet [cabinet_id], Slot [slot_id].
Event = [string].
Description:
There is a link event for the T1 SRU at the specified location.
The event is either of the following: 1) Channels reconnected for T1 link, or 2)
Channels disconnected for T1 link. When the channels have been
disconnected all voice channels have been taken out of service. When the
channels have been reconnected, the number of voice channels specified by
the maintenance limit are available for use.
Action:
Refer to previous log for direction.
0002/0000
Message:
Voice Link Event for T1 SRU. Event = Link placed in Standby
BusiedOut\Standby Inservice\\state.
Global Event
Description:
One of the T1 links has experienced a change in state. If a link
is placed “StandBy BusiedOut” or “Standby InService”, the state change is
normal and has been made either by program control or as requested through
T1 Maintenance.
Action:
First RTP is an integer (decimal) indicating the cabinet number of the
T1. Next RTP is an integer (decimal) indicating the slot number of the T1. Next
number is an integer (selector) specifying the event.
0002/0001
Message:
Voice Trunk Event for T1 SRU in Cabinet [cabinet_id], Slot
[slot_id]. Channel = [channel#_id]. Event = [string]. DMS CLLI = [DMS_id],
Trunk ID = [trunk_id].
Description:
One of the following voice trunk events occurred for the T1
SRU at the specified location: 1) Trunk placed in remote answer state, 2) Trunk
placed in remote seized state, 3) Trunk placed in seize failure state, 4) Trunk
placed in trunk failure state, 5) Channel allocation failure. Trunk not found in T1
configuration, 6) Channel allocation failure. Trunk not available (not inservice),
7) Call aborted on trunk due to T1 failure or T1 maintenance action,
Action:
If trunk state is remote answer or remote seized, clear condition by
making the far-end go on-hook. If trunk state is seize failure or trunk failure,
clear error through T1 maintenance. If trunk state indicates an allocation
problem, make sure that the DMS CLLI and TrunkID are correctly datafilled
under the Digital Trunk Link configuration service.

19. DMS notices
Some events which occur in the TOPS VSN must be reported to the DMS switch.
The report takes the form of a notification message. The list which follows
identifies the log/alarm messages sent to the DMS. table VSNALARM on the
DMS, which is datafilled by the operating company, adds severity and textual
information to the notification message before it is output on the DMS side. The
event ID given here corresponds directly to the alarm code in table
VSNALARM.
Sub-
system Report & Error
Number Event Event ID Severity Alarm
8720 0003 0002 Faulty PRU 1 minor Yes
8720 0003 0004 PRU Recovered 1 No
8720 0003 0001 Faulty SRU Device 2 minor Yes
8720 0003 0003 SRU Device Recovered 2 No
8720 0002 0001 Disk Full 3 critical Yes
8720 0002 0004 Disk Space Reclaimed 3 No
8722 0001 0001 External Alarm 4 major Yes
8722 0001 0002 External Alarm Recovered 4 No
8722 0002 0001 External. Alarm 4 major Yes
8722 0002 0002 External Alarm Recovered 4 No
8722 0003 0001 External Alarm 4 minor Yes
8722 0003 0002 External Alarm Recovered 4 No
9443 0003 0001 Inserv T1 Failed 5 major Yes
9443 0003 0002 Inserv T1 Recovered 5 No
9443 0003 0003 Busied T1 Failed 6 minor Yes
9443 0003 0004 Busied T1 Recovered 6 No
9442 0000 0104 ACPE Capacity Lost 7 minor Yes
9442 0000 0000 ACPE Recovered 7 No
